    Rates are different around the country, so I’m not going to get into exact dollars, but that would be a half day shoot. Than probably 6-8 hours motion graphics work. Figure out your rates, go from there.

    For me, Yes, but i’ve done it before and know the workflow but that’s reflected in my rates.

    For fireworks, check out Particular’s Pyro Pack, that’s pretty much how I learned to create good looking one’s in AE.

    Also if you register with Red Giant People you can download some more free Fireworks Presets for particular.
